Westgate: Skilled Care & Rehab For Recovery

Westgate Health & Rehabilitation Center provides skilled nursing care, physical therapy, occupational therapy, and speech therapy to patients recovering from illness, injury, or surgery. The center’s team of experienced professionals works closely with patients and their families to develop individualized treatment plans that promote healing and recovery. Westgate Health & Rehabilitation Center is committed to providing compassionate and comprehensive care in a comfortable and supportive environment.

Facilities: Impacting Patient Outcomes

Facilities: The Stage for Patient Recovery

Picture this: a hospital room bathed in soft, natural light, with comfortable chairs, soothing colors, and a view of the lush greenery outside. In this tranquil setting, patients feel relaxed, comfortable, and more likely to heal.

Now, imagine the opposite: a dark, cramped, noisy room with outdated equipment and an air of neglect. It’s no wonder patients in such environments experience higher stress, slower recovery times, and increased readmission rates.

Why is the physical environment of a healthcare facility so crucial?

  • Improved patient satisfaction: Comfortable and inviting facilities make patients feel more at home, reducing anxiety and improving their overall experience.
  • Enhanced healing outcomes: Natural light, fresh air, and ergonomic designs promote physical and mental well-being, facilitating faster recovery.
  • Reduced healthcare costs: Well-designed facilities can prevent falls, infections, and other complications, saving healthcare systems money in the long run.

Let’s dive into some specific examples:

  • Single-occupancy rooms: These private spaces provide patients with privacy, rest, and a reduced risk of infection.
  • Nature-inspired designs: Studies have shown that exposure to natural elements like plants, water, and sunlight calms patients, reduces stress, and promotes healing.
  • Patient-centered technology: Smart beds, interactive touchscreens, and remote monitoring systems empower patients to actively participate in their own healthcare.

In conclusion, healthcare facilities are not just buildings; they are tools that shape patient outcomes. By investing in comfortable, healing environments, we can boost patient satisfaction, improve recovery times, and ultimately create a more compassionate healthcare system. Insurance Companies: Balancing Costs and Access

Imagine you’re planning a grand adventure, let’s call it “Operation Amazing Trip.” But then, you realize you need some “Adventure Dollars” to make your dream a reality. That’s where insurance companies step in as your financial superheroes, ready to help you gather those adventure dollars!

Insurance companies are like the gatekeepers of healthcare funds. They receive money from people who want to protect themselves against unexpected medical expenses, like that time you tried snowboarding and ended up in a plaster cast! In return, insurance companies promise to cover some or all of your medical bills if you get sick or injured.

But here’s the balancing act: insurance companies have to ensure they have enough adventure dollars to cover everyone’s needs while also keeping those premiums (the cost of your adventure dollars) affordable. It’s like riding a bike with two baskets, one filled with adventure dollars and the other with premiums – you need to keep both baskets relatively equal.

This balancing act can sometimes affect access to care. Insurance policies can have different rules about which treatments, procedures, and medications they cover. Some policies may have deductibles, which are like a small investment you make in your adventure before insurance kicks in. Others may require you to use specific healthcare providers or facilities, which can limit your choices.

So, it’s important to carefully review your insurance policy and understand its coverage before you find yourself on the quest for medical adventure.
